Efficient and Reliable Performance
Powered by an 800cc engine, the Mehran is tailored for urban driving. While not built for high-speed thrills, its engine provides just the right balance of power and fuel economy. It’s ideal for stop-and-go traffic and short commutes, offering impressive mileage that keeps fuel costs to a minimum.
Key Performance Highlights:
Feature | Specification |
---|---|
Engine | 800cc, 3-cylinder |
Transmission | Manual (Auto optional) |
Fuel Efficiency | Estimated 18–22 km/l |
Top Speed | Approx. 120 km/h |
This efficiency and practicality make it a top contender for anyone needing a reliable city car.
Enhanced Safety for Peace of Mind
Safety has never been the Mehran’s strongest suit—until now. The 2025 version includes several much-needed updates that make it safer than ever:
- Dual front airbags
- ABS (Anti-lock Braking System)
- Rear parking sensors
- Child lock system
- Reinforced body structure
For a car in this price segment, these are meaningful improvements that significantly increase its appeal.
A Simple but Smart Interior
Inside, the Mehran receives a cleaner dashboard layout and comfier seating. The materials are still basic but feel more polished than before. Perhaps the biggest leap is the addition of a 7-inch touchscreen infotainment system, supporting both Android Auto and Apple CarPlay.
Other Notable Features:
- Bluetooth and USB connectivity
- Air conditioning (standard across variants)
- Power steering
- Central locking
- Optional rear camera
These upgrades transform the Mehran from a bare-bones ride into a surprisingly connected one.

Budget-Friendly Pricing
Suzuki is targeting first-time buyers and budget-conscious families with competitive pricing that aligns with its value-driven brand. Here’s an estimate of the expected pricing range:
Variant | Estimated Price (PKR) |
---|---|
Base (Manual) | 1,250,000 |
Mid (Manual + Safety) | 1,400,000 |
Top (Touchscreen + Auto) | 1,550,000 – 1,650,000 |
This pricing keeps the Mehran accessible to students, small families, and anyone in need of a dependable second vehicle.
